Plenary approves opinion that gives benefits to members of the neighborhood boards

The national representation approved, unanimously (114 votes), the opinion fallen to bills 4559/2022-CR 4868/2022-CR 7004/2023-CR and 6712/2023-CR, 6821/2023-CR, which proposes to modify Law 29701, in order to grant benefits in favor of the members of the neighborhood meetings Citizen Security neighborhoods.

“This law is an investment in social cohesion, justice and equity, since it empowers the members of our neighborhood organizations,” said Congresswoman Patricia Chirinos, secretary of the Defense Commission and who sustained the opinion held on bills 5404, 6716 and 6821, which proposes to modify Law 29701 and expand the benefits of neighborhood boards.

The Secretary of the Decentralization, Regionalization, Local Governments and Modernization of State Management, Elizabeth Taipe Coronado, supported the proposal indicating that, at a time when the country is whipped by crime and insecurity, they need to act with determination and recognize the contribution in the citizen security of the members of the neighborhood boards.

The work of the neighborhood boards is a clear example of solidarity, organization and civic commitment, given the incessant progress of crime, said Taipe Coronado.

According to the approved text, the National Registry of Neighborhood Boards of Citizen Security is created by the National Police, to identify the members of the neighborhood boards and their representatives.

“In order to guarantee the execution of preventive and deterrent measures that contribute to improving the levels of security and tranquility at the local level, the National Police, as well as the regional governments and local governments, are empowered to temporarily assign the neighborhood boards, goods related to citizen security, and must establish, the entity that assigns, a supervision procedure on the correct use of the assets assigned,” says the initiative.

Likewise, the members of the neighborhood boards will be the subject of benefits to encourage their voluntary participation in the fight against crime and insecurity, including an additional score in public tenders to access study scholarships for them or their children.

The approved initiative establishes that it is local governments that can grant these incentives in competitions organized by the National Scholarships and Educational Credit Program (PRONABEC).

The proposal also includes its participation in the public hearings of local and regional governments, in participatory budgets, attend in the formulation of security plans and transmit the needs of citizens, among others.

Meanwhile, the president of the Budget Commission, Alejandro Soto Reyes, supported the opinion of projects 4868, 7004 and 7186, which proposes to modify article 1 of Law 29010, which empowers regional governments and local governments to dispose of resources in favor of the National Police, in order to authorize the transfer of part of their institutional budget in favor of citizen security.
